The Evolution of Visual Symbols in Gaming Interfaces

From early arcade interfaces to modern mobile applications, game developers have consistently relied on universally understood symbols to communicate complex functions efficiently. This transition is driven by a fundamental principle: sensory shortcuts reduce cognitive load and streamline user experience.

Understanding the Symbolism: Why the Life Preserver & Tackle Box?

In context, the life preserver icon symbolizes safety, rescue, and progress—offering players a visual assurance that they are within a controlled, user-friendly environment. Similarly, the tackle box icon visually represents gear management, inventory, or in-game tools, directly connecting gameplay mechanics with familiar fishing paraphernalia.

Functional Significance and Design Philosophy

Designing intuitive UI symbols hinges on balancing aesthetic appeal with functional clarity. The life preserver & tackle box symbols exemplify this ethos through:

  • Immediate recognizability: Users easily associate the icons with related functions based on real-world analogs.
  • Consistency: Recurrent use across interfaces maintains user intuition.
  • Thematic coherence: Icons reinforce the maritime and fishing themes, enriching immersion.

Expert Recommendations for Icon Integration in Niche Gaming Contexts

When incorporating symbolic icons into your fishing game, consider these best practices:

  1. Align icons with both gameplay mechanics and thematic elements.
  2. Utilise universally recognised symbols to lower onboarding barriers.
  3. Ensure consistency across all interface elements to build user trust.
  4. Incorporate subtle animations for dynamic feedback—e.g., a softly moving life preserver to indicate active safety features.
